## Runbook: Sensor drift — GroweWatch controller

Symptom: humidity/temp readings diverge from the handheld reference by >2 units. Usual cause: probe drift in bays 3–6, worst in summer.

Steps: take a manual reading at the probe, compare against the dashboard, and log the delta. If delta exceeds the calibration threshold, trigger a recalibration cycle from the Hallvik console — takes ~10 minutes, vents stay closed during it. Do not swap probes without logging. Current controller configuration for reference.

deployment values, kajep-kageg:
[praix]
host = praix.paliqcorp.corp
user = praix_svc
database = praix_prod

# Break-Glass: Catalog Cache Invalidation

Scope: the Pinrow product catalog at Veldstone Retail. If stale prices persist after a purge and the Hollowmere invalidation queue is wedged, use break-glass to flush the edge tier directly. Contractors: get verbal sign-off from the catalog lead first. Steps: open the Hollowmere admin shell, select emergency-flush, confirm the tenant, and run it once — repeated flushes thrash the origin. Access is logged and expires after 20 minutes. Unseal the admin shell with the passphrase below.

recovery phrase for kahop-tajog: istix-casvan

### Hot-Reloading Config

Good news: you almost never need to restart Pondrel to pick up config changes. The service watches its config bundle in Cobbleshed and applies updates in place — feature flags, rate limits, and routing weights all reload within about ten seconds. Schema-breaking changes are the exception; those still need a rolling restart. To push a new bundle from your machine, use the `pondrel-cfg push` CLI, which talks to the Cobbleshed API. It authenticates with the team's internal key, shown here for convenience.

API key for fahip-kahip: zpat23_XiJGUHz5xfaAtaIqUkus0rh